The Assault on Yonah Mountain is an annual trail event held in Cleveland, Georgia, featuring a challenging 2.25-mile ascent from the base to the summit of Yonah Mountain. Participants run, hike, or ruck up 1,650 vertical feet over a course that includes gravel roads, rocky sections, and steep single-track trails. The climb is divided into three parts: a gradual bottom section, a steep and technical middle with rock gardens, and a tiring top section with a consistent 12-20% grade.

The event emphasizes safety, recommending trail shoes and fitness preparation. Finishers receive medals, and the race supports trail maintenance efforts.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
